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?
Asset security is necessary for funding of more than $150,000. This is by way of charge over assets, and may include the registration of this in the PPSR or registering as a caveat.
A personal or director’s ensure is a commitment to repay a loan which is generally in nature rather than stating the security for a particular asset. The person who signs the guarantee is personally accountable if the business borrower is unable to make the repayment.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is a central, national online register operated by the New Zealand Government. It contains security interests registered in respect of person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R permits prioritisation over property that is personal to be granted in accordance with the date on which a security interest was registered.
A caveat is a legal document that is filed to offer the public notice of a legal claim to property.

About business loans
How do you define asset-based lending (a secured loan)?
Asset-based borrowing is when the company owner uses an asset they own to get a loan. The asset can be either an individual asset, such as the family home, or a company asset such as a truck as well as a piece of machine.
The majority of lending institutions, not just the major banks, prefer to secure loans against an asset. If you’re having trouble paying back the loan, the asset could be transferred to the lender. In essence it is means of securing new financing by using the worth of the asset you already have.
